"""
Parameters Overview Application Routes.
======================================
This module provides system parameter visualization and management functionality including
component listing, parameter retrieval, and system overview.
"""
import json
import os
from flask import Blueprint, current_app, jsonify, request
# Create the parameters overview application blueprint
app_parameters_overview = Blueprint("app_parameters_overview", __name__)
[docs]
@app_parameters_overview.route("/app/parameters_overview/get_component_list", methods=["POST"])
def get_component_list():
"""Get list of components from the project."""
data = request.get_json()
project_name = data.get("field_name")
project_folder_path = os.path.join(current_app.config["GEMINI_PROJECT_FOLDER"], project_name)
component_list = []
for file in os.listdir(project_folder_path):
if file.endswith(".param"):
component_list.append(file[0:-6])
return jsonify(component_list)

def convert_trajectory_table(input_table):
"""Convert column-wise to row-wise table."""
keys_list = list(input_table.keys())
num_steps = int(len(input_table[keys_list[0]]))
output_table = []
for ii in range(num_steps):
new_row = dict()
for key in keys_list:
new_row[key] = input_table[key][ii]
output_table.append(new_row)
return output_table
